Description

4-n-Butoxyphenylacetohydroxamic Acid, o-Formate Ester is a specialized organic compound belonging to the hydroxamic acid ester class. This chemical serves as a valuable intermediate or building block in advanced organic synthesis, particularly for the development of pharmaceuticals and agrochemicals. It is primarily utilized by research institutions, fine chemical manufacturers, and pharmaceutical R&D departments for creating novel active ingredients and complex molecules.

Application

  • Pharmaceutical Intermediate: Key building block in the synthesis of potential drug candidates, especially those targeting enzyme inhibition.
  • Agrochemical Research: Used in the development of novel herbicides, fungicides, or plant growth regulators.
  • Chemical Synthesis: Serves as a versatile precursor for introducing the hydroxamic acid functional group into more complex molecular architectures.
  • Metallurgy & Chelation: Potential application as a ligand or chelating agent for specific metal ions in analytical or extraction processes.
  • Material Science Research: Investigated for use in creating specialized polymers or coatings with unique properties.

Basic Information

Product Name 4-n-Butoxyphenylacetohydroxamic Acid, o-Formate Ester
CAS No. 76790-19-7
Molecular Formula C13H17NO4
Molecular Weight 251.28 g/mol
Synonyms 4-Butoxyphenylacetohydroxamic Acid Formate Ester; o-Formyl 4-Butoxyphenylacetohydroxamate; Acetohydroxamic Acid, 4-Butoxyphenyl-, o-Formate Ester; N-Formyl-4-butoxybenzeneacetohydroxamic Acid; 4-n-Butoxybenzeneacetohydroxamic Acid Formyl Ester; [4-(Butoxy)phenyl]acetohydroxamic Acid o-Formate; Contact for additional trade names.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after opening to prevent degradation from atmospheric moisture.
